Allan Thompson Book Signing Dec. 6 at Library Center

December 1, 2014 — Springfield author and chaplain Allan Thompson will sell and sign copies of his books, “‘Tis Grace: A Story of God’s Redemption” and “What Salvation Is” from 11 a.m.-2 p.m. on Saturday, Dec. 6, in the Library Center concourse, 4653 S. Campbell Ave.

In “‘Tis Grace,” Thompson candidly tells of his struggles with insecurity, which led to his alcoholism, and his continuing struggles with poor self-esteem and other issues even after his conversion to Christianity.

In “What Salvation Is,” Thomson shares what he has learned through the telling of God’s saving work in the life of the Apostle Paul and writes of God’s involvement in the lives of some well-known Christians through the centuries.
